
Repairing cracked shower tiles can be a daunting task, but one potential solution is to cover the damaged tile with a new one. This approach may seem straightforward, but it requires careful consideration and planning to ensure a successful outcome. Before attempting this repair, it's essential to assess the extent of the damage, as well as the condition of the surrounding tiles and the underlying substrate. If the crack is minor and the surrounding tiles are in good condition, covering the cracked tile with a new one might be a viable option. However, if the damage is more extensive or the substrate is compromised, a more comprehensive repair or replacement may be necessary. By understanding the limitations and requirements of this method, homeowners can make an informed decision about whether covering a cracked shower tile with a new tile is the best course of action for their specific situation.

Surface Preparation: Clean, dry, and level cracked tile area before applying new tile
Before attempting to cover a cracked shower tile with a new one, the success of the repair hinges on meticulous surface preparation. Neglecting this step can lead to adhesion failure, water infiltration, or an uneven finish. The cracked tile area must be treated as a canvas—clean, dry, and level—to ensure the new tile bonds securely and blends seamlessly with the existing surface.
Cleaning the Surface: Removing Debris and Residue
Begin by thoroughly cleaning the cracked tile and surrounding grout lines. Use a mild detergent mixed with warm water to remove soap scum, mildew, and mineral deposits common in shower environments. For stubborn stains or grease, a non-acidic tile cleaner or a mixture of baking soda and water can be effective. Scrub the area with a stiff brush or nylon pad, ensuring all residue is eliminated. Rinse the surface with clean water and allow it to dry completely. Any leftover grime or moisture can compromise the adhesive’s ability to bond, leading to premature failure.
Drying the Area: Preventing Moisture Trapping
Moisture is the enemy of tile adhesion, especially in showers where water exposure is constant. After cleaning, use a clean cloth or towel to absorb excess water, followed by a hairdryer or heat gun on a low setting to ensure the area is thoroughly dry. Pay special attention to grout lines and the edges of the cracked tile, as these areas tend to retain moisture. For best results, allow the surface to air-dry for at least 24 hours before proceeding. If humidity is high, consider using a dehumidifier to expedite the process.
Leveling the Surface: Ensuring a Smooth Foundation
A cracked tile often results in an uneven surface, which can cause the new tile to sit improperly or create stress points that lead to further cracking. To level the area, apply a thin layer of tile adhesive or epoxy filler to the cracked tile, smoothing it with a putty knife until it is flush with the surrounding tiles. Allow the filler to cure according to the manufacturer’s instructions—typically 24 to 48 hours. Once cured, lightly sand the area with fine-grit sandpaper to remove any excess material and create a smooth, even surface. This step is crucial for both aesthetic and structural integrity.
Final Inspection: A Critical Pre-Installation Check
Before applying the new tile, inspect the prepared surface for any imperfections. Run your hand over the area to ensure it is level and free of debris. Use a flashlight at different angles to detect any remaining gaps or unevenness. If issues are found, repeat the cleaning, drying, or leveling steps as necessary. A well-prepared surface not only ensures a professional finish but also extends the lifespan of the repair, saving time and money in the long run.
By prioritizing these surface preparation steps, you create an optimal foundation for the new tile, transforming a cracked shower tile from an eyesore into a durable, seamless repair.

Adhesive Selection: Use waterproof, flexible tile adhesive for shower environments
Shower environments demand adhesives that can withstand constant moisture, temperature fluctuations, and movement without failing. Waterproof, flexible tile adhesives are specifically engineered for these conditions, forming a durable bond that resists cracking and peeling over time. Unlike standard adhesives, which may degrade in wet areas, these specialized products contain polymers that allow for slight expansion and contraction, accommodating the natural shifts in tile and substrate materials.
Selecting the right adhesive involves understanding its composition and application requirements. Look for products labeled as "waterproof" and "flexible," often designated for wet areas like showers. These adhesives typically come in powdered form, requiring mixing with water to achieve a smooth, trowelable consistency. Follow the manufacturer’s instructions for water-to-powder ratios—usually around 5-6 liters of water per 20kg bag—to ensure optimal adhesion. Applying the adhesive with a notched trowel ensures even coverage, typically at a depth of 3-5mm, depending on the tile size and substrate condition.
Flexibility is a critical feature, particularly when covering cracked tiles. Rigid adhesives can transfer stress to the new tile, leading to further cracking or detachment. Flexible adhesives, however, absorb movement, reducing the risk of failure. For instance, polymer-modified cementitious adhesives (often labeled as "Type II" or "improved") offer superior flexibility compared to traditional cement-based options. These are ideal for shower repairs, where the substrate may have minor imperfections or where tiles are exposed to frequent thermal changes.
Practical tips can enhance the adhesive’s performance. Ensure the substrate is clean, dry, and free of loose material before application. If the cracked tile is not removed, roughen its surface with sandpaper to improve adhesion. Allow the adhesive to cure fully—typically 24-48 hours—before exposing it to water. For added protection, apply a waterproof membrane over the adhesive layer, especially in high-moisture areas like shower floors. This dual-layer approach ensures long-term durability, even in challenging environments.
In summary, choosing a waterproof, flexible tile adhesive is non-negotiable for shower tile repairs. Its ability to bond securely, accommodate movement, and resist moisture makes it the ideal choice for covering cracked tiles. By following precise mixing and application guidelines, you can achieve a professional finish that stands the test of time, transforming a compromised shower surface into a resilient, water-tight area.

Tile Matching: Choose new tile that matches existing size, color, and texture
Matching tiles to cover a cracked shower tile is an art that hinges on precision. Start by measuring the existing tile’s dimensions—length, width, and thickness—using a ruler or caliper for accuracy. Even a millimeter’s difference can disrupt alignment, so opt for tiles with identical or near-identical sizes. Manufacturers often label tiles with their exact measurements, making this step easier. If the original tile is discontinued, consider trimming a slightly larger tile to fit, but beware: cutting can alter the edge texture, requiring additional sanding or filing for seamless integration.
Color matching is where many DIYers falter, as lighting and age can skew perception. Bring a sample of the existing tile to the store, but don’t rely solely on visual comparison. Hold the new tile next to the old one in the same lighting conditions as your shower—natural daylight is best. If the original tile has faded or discolored, consider using a tile with a slightly darker shade, as it will lighten over time. For textured tiles, compare under different angles to ensure the pattern and finish align. If the exact match is unavailable, opt for a complementary tile that blends rather than contrasts.
Texture plays a subtle but critical role in tile matching. Glossy tiles paired with matte finishes or smooth tiles next to embossed ones will create visual and tactile dissonance. Run your hand over the existing tile to assess its surface characteristics, then seek a new tile with a similar feel. If the original tile has a unique texture, such as a hammered or brushed finish, prioritize finding an exact match. In some cases, applying a clear sealant or glaze to the new tile can help unify the textures, but this is a last resort and may not yield perfect results.
Practical tips can streamline the matching process. Use a tile-matching app or consult a professional at a tile store to cross-reference manufacturer catalogs. If the shower has multiple cracked tiles, purchase extra new tiles to account for future repairs. For older homes, consider sourcing tiles from salvage yards or specialty retailers that stock vintage styles. Finally, test the new tile’s compatibility by placing it next to the existing ones in the shower area before installation. This dry run will reveal any discrepancies in size, color, or texture, allowing you to make adjustments before committing to adhesive or grout.

Grouting Tips: Apply mildew-resistant grout to ensure durability and water resistance
Mildew-resistant grout isn’t just a luxury—it’s a necessity in moisture-prone areas like showers. Standard grout absorbs water, fostering mold and mildew growth, which weakens tile adhesion and compromises aesthetics. Mildew-resistant grout, however, contains additives like silicone or latex that repel water and inhibit fungal growth. This ensures your repair not only looks seamless but also withstands the humid environment of a shower. Without it, even a perfectly installed tile risks premature failure due to water damage.
Selecting the right mildew-resistant grout involves more than picking a color. Opt for epoxy or polyurethane-based grouts, which offer superior water resistance compared to cementitious options. For cracked shower tile repairs, choose a sanded grout for joints wider than 1/8 inch; unsanded works for narrower gaps. Ensure the grout’s color matches or complements the existing tile to avoid visual discrepancies. Always follow manufacturer instructions for mixing ratios—typically one part water to 25 parts grout powder—to achieve optimal consistency.
Application precision is critical for durability. After setting the new tile, allow the adhesive to cure fully before grouting. Apply the mildew-resistant grout diagonally across the tile surface using a rubber float, pressing it firmly into the joints. Remove excess grout with the float’s edge, then let it haze for 10–15 minutes. Wipe the surface with a damp sponge, rinsing frequently to avoid pulling grout from the joints. Avoid over-cleaning, as this can weaken the grout’s bond.
Maintenance extends the life of your grout and tile repair. Seal the grout 72 hours after application with a penetrating sealer to enhance water resistance. Reapply the sealer annually, or as recommended by the manufacturer. Regularly clean the shower with pH-neutral cleaners to prevent soap scum buildup, which can degrade grout over time. Inspect the grout lines every six months for cracks or discoloration, addressing issues promptly to avoid water infiltration beneath the tile.
Compared to traditional grout, mildew-resistant options offer a higher upfront cost but save money long-term by reducing repair frequency. While standard grout may suffice in dry areas, showers demand the added protection of specialized products. By investing in mildew-resistant grout and following proper application and maintenance practices, you ensure your cracked tile repair remains functional and attractive for years, avoiding the need for repeated interventions.

Sealing Edges: Seal edges with silicone caulk to prevent water seepage
Silicone caulk is the unsung hero of tile repair, particularly when covering cracked shower tiles with new ones. Its primary role is to create a watertight seal along the edges, preventing moisture from seeping behind the tiles and causing further damage. Without this step, even the most meticulously installed tile can become a breeding ground for mold, mildew, and structural issues. Think of silicone caulk as the invisible shield that safeguards your investment, ensuring longevity and functionality.
Applying silicone caulk correctly requires precision and patience. Begin by cleaning the edges thoroughly, removing any debris, old caulk, or soap scum. Use a utility knife or caulk removal tool to scrape away existing sealant, ensuring a smooth surface for adhesion. Next, load a high-quality silicone caulk gun with a tube of waterproof silicone specifically designed for bathrooms. Cut the nozzle at a 45-degree angle to control the bead size, aiming for a consistent line that fills the gap between the tile and the wall or adjacent tiles. Smooth the caulk with a damp finger or a caulk-smoothing tool, removing excess and creating a seamless finish. Allow the caulk to cure fully, typically 24 hours, before exposing it to water.
While silicone caulk is effective, it’s not foolproof. Common mistakes include using too much or too little caulk, which can lead to unsightly gaps or bulging seams. Another pitfall is rushing the curing process, as premature water exposure can compromise the seal. To avoid these issues, practice on a scrap surface before tackling your shower. Additionally, choose a caulk color that matches your grout or tiles for a cohesive look. For added durability, opt for a mold-resistant formula, especially in humid environments.
Comparing silicone caulk to alternative sealing methods highlights its superiority. Acrylic caulk, for instance, is less flexible and prone to cracking over time, making it unsuitable for shower applications. Epoxy grout, while durable, lacks the elasticity needed to accommodate tile movement caused by temperature fluctuations. Silicone caulk strikes the perfect balance, offering both flexibility and water resistance. Its ease of application and affordability further solidify its position as the go-to solution for sealing tile edges in wet areas.
In practice, sealing edges with silicone caulk is a small but critical step in covering cracked shower tiles. It transforms a potentially temporary fix into a lasting solution, protecting your shower from water damage and maintaining its aesthetic appeal. By mastering this technique, you not only address the immediate issue but also prevent future problems, ensuring your shower remains functional and beautiful for years to come.
